import { vi } from "vitest";
import type { DGSupabaseClient } from "@repo/database/lib/client";

export const IMAGE =
"https://firebasestorage.googleapis.com/v0/b/firescript-577a2.appspot.com/o/imgs%2Fapp%2FMAPLab%2FlqP2ioVNC3.png?alt=media&token=9f1c07a4";

type Row = {
space_id?: unknown;
source_local_id?: unknown;
filepath?: unknown;
filehash?: unknown;
source_path?: unknown;
};

/**
* A stand-in for Supabase covering what the stage leans on: `my_file_references` answers
* per node, `file_exists` answers from the rows already written, and a delete honours the
* `eq`/`notIn` filters so cleanup can be asserted rather than assumed.
*/
export const makeClient = () => {
const rows: Row[] = [];
const upload = vi.fn().mockResolvedValue({ error: null });
const thenable = (result: unknown) => ({
then: (resolve: (value: unknown) => unknown) =>
Promise.resolve(result).then(resolve),
});

type Filter = (row: Row) => boolean;
const filtered = (filters: Filter[]) =>
rows.filter((row) => filters.every((f) => f(row)));

/** Set to make the reference read fail, as an offline client would. */
let selectError: { message: string } | null = null;

const selects: number[] = [];
const deletes: number[] = [];

const selectBuilder = (filters: Filter[]) => {
const builder = {
eq: (column: string, value: unknown) =>
selectBuilder([
...filters,
(row) => row[column as keyof Row] === value,
]),
in: (column: string, values: unknown[]) =>
selectBuilder([
...filters,
(row) => values.includes(row[column as keyof Row]),
]),
then: (resolve: (value: unknown) => unknown) => {
selects.push(1);
return Promise.resolve(
selectError
? { data: null, error: selectError }
: { data: filtered(filters), error: null },
).then(resolve);
},
};
return builder;
};

const deleteBuilder = (filters: Filter[]) => ({
eq: (column: string, value: unknown) =>
deleteBuilder([...filters, (row) => row[column as keyof Row] === value]),
notIn: (column: string, values: unknown[]) =>
deleteBuilder([
...filters,
(row) => !values.includes(row[column as keyof Row]),
]),
then: (resolve: (value: unknown) => unknown) => {
deletes.push(1);
for (const row of filtered(filters)) rows.splice(rows.indexOf(row), 1);
return Promise.resolve({ error: null }).then(resolve);
},
});

/** Set to make the content upload fail, so what follows it can be asserted. */
let contentUploadError: { message: string } | null = null;

const rpc = vi.fn((fn: string, { hashvalue }: { hashvalue?: string }) =>
Promise.resolve(
fn === "upsert_content" && contentUploadError
? { data: null, error: contentUploadError }
: { data: rows.some((row) => row.filehash === hashvalue), error: null },
),
);
const tableOperations = () => ({
select: vi.fn(() => selectBuilder([])),
delete: vi.fn(() => deleteBuilder([])),
insert: vi.fn((row: Row) => {
rows.push({ ...row });
return thenable({ error: null });
}),
update: vi.fn(() => {
const builder = {
eq: vi.fn(() => builder),
then: thenable({ error: null }).then,
};
return builder;
}),
});
// Typed with the table name so a test can assert which table was touched.
const from =
vi.fn<(table: string) => ReturnType<typeof tableOperations>>(
tableOperations,
);

const client = {
rpc,
storage: { from: vi.fn(() => ({ upload })) },
from,
} as unknown as DGSupabaseClient;
return {
client,
rpc,
from,
rows,
upload,
filepaths: () => rows.map((r) => r.filepath),
selectCount: () => selects.length,
deleteCount: () => deletes.length,
failReferenceRead: (message: string) => {
selectError = { message };
},
failContentUpload: (message: string) => {
contentUploadError = { message };
},
};
};

/**
* Both reads an asset takes: the descriptor over `fetch`, and the bytes through Roam.
* Returns Roam's `get` so a test can assert that nothing was transferred.
*/
export const mockAssetReads = ({
size = 7,
bytes = "PNGDATA",
descriptorOk = true,
}: {
size?: number;
bytes?: string;
descriptorOk?: boolean;
}) => {
vi.stubGlobal(
"fetch",
vi.fn(() =>
Promise.resolve({
ok: descriptorOk,
status: descriptorOk ? 200 : 500,
json: () =>
Promise.resolve({
name: "imgs/app/MAPLab/lqP2ioVNC3.png",
contentType: "image/png",
size: String(size),
metadata: { "file-name": "diagram.png" },
}),
} as unknown as Response),
),
);
const get = vi.fn(() =>
Promise.resolve(new File([bytes], "diagram.png", { type: "image/png" })),
);
vi.stubGlobal("window", {
roamAlphaAPI: {
file: { get },
graph: { name: "MAPLab", isEncrypted: false },
},
});
return { get };
};
